Nice Mini-Set
" This set contains 426 pieces, it has two (2) small instruction booklets, and the Lego pieces come in three (3) sealed, and numbered plastic bags. This allows the set to be assembled in sub-sections using a very small area. If you are fortunate enough to already have Lego Star Wars sets #7666, #10178, #7879, and #7749, when combined with this set (#75014) and a little white cloth (snow) this combination of Lego sets makes a pretty impressive display! With regard to instruction book #2 I have one caution. On page-12 it calls for two (2) #300401 blocks when only one (1) is required. This set is fairly easy to construct, it only took me a day or so working nice and easy, not rushing, and enjoying myself! "

Well Planned
" I found this kit a tremendous addition to my Star Wars Lego Collection. The set designer did a very good job planning and layout the various easy to follow steps used in constructing this kit. The Instruction booklets, of which there are three (3) are straight forward and easy to follow. What makes the construction of this kit so nice is that the parts are sealed in numbered bags, which allows you to easily construct the various subassemblies, while doing so utilizing a small "work space". This kit was FUN! The Star Wars enthusiast will take notice of serveral key elements of this set, not the least of which is the "helmet drums", and C3PO's levitating chair (nice touches)! If I were able to make a suggestion, it would be to develop a battery operated LED lighting kit to enhanse the fireplace, walking paths (between the trees) and backlighting for the tree houses (like the night time shot in the movie). I commend LEGO and the kit Designer for such a great kit! "
